Community Development Trust Passed
By 250 News
While all provinces have yet to sign on for the funding, the legislation designed to provide $1 billion dollars for a Community Development Trust has been passed unanimously in Ottawa.
The fund now waits for the approval of the Senate.
Once approved, the Community Development Trust will provide fundig for job training in sectors which face labour shortages, it will also provide community transition plans to foster economic development, creat enew jobs and infrastructure development to stimulate economic diversification.
The fund was developed in the wake of job losses in communities which are reliant on single resources. It is expected the funding will assist communities like Mackenzie which are facing significant losses because of the downturn in the forest sector.
